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(255)

Side by Side Diff: content/content_tests.gypi

Issue 1417753004: Reland Switch Chrome Android using v8 arch specific external data name (Closed) Base URL: https://chromium.googlesource.com/chromium/src.git@master
Patch Set: rebase Created 5 years, 1 month 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View unified diff | Download patch
« no previous file with comments | « content/content_shell.gypi ('k') | content/shell/android/BUILD.gn » ('j') | no next file with comments »
Toggle Intra-line Diffs ('i') | Expand Comments ('e') | Collapse Comments ('c') | Show Comments Hide Comments ('s')
OLDNEW
1 # Copyright (c) 2013 The Chromium Authors. All rights reserved. 1 # Copyright (c) 2013 The Chromium Authors. All rights reserved.
2 # Use of this source code is governed by a BSD-style license that can be 2 # Use of this source code is governed by a BSD-style license that can be
3 # found in the LICENSE file. 3 # found in the LICENSE file.
4 4
5 { 5 {
6 'variables': { 6 'variables': {
7 'layouttest_support_content_sources': [ 7 'layouttest_support_content_sources': [
8 'public/test/layouttest_support.h', 8 'public/test/layouttest_support.h',
9 'public/test/nested_message_pump_android.cc', 9 'public/test/nested_message_pump_android.cc',
10 'public/test/nested_message_pump_android.h', 10 'public/test/nested_message_pump_android.h',
(...skipping 997 matching lines...) Expand 10 before | Expand all | Expand 10 after
1008 ], 1008 ],
1009 'dependencies': [ 1009 'dependencies': [
1010 '../ui/compositor/compositor.gyp:compositor', 1010 '../ui/compositor/compositor.gyp:compositor',
1011 '../third_party/libvpx_new/libvpx.gyp:libvpx_new', 1011 '../third_party/libvpx_new/libvpx.gyp:libvpx_new',
1012 ], 1012 ],
1013 }], 1013 }],
1014 ['OS=="android"', { 1014 ['OS=="android"', {
1015 'dependencies': [ 1015 'dependencies': [
1016 '../ui/android/ui_android.gyp:ui_android', 1016 '../ui/android/ui_android.gyp:ui_android',
1017 '../ui/shell_dialogs/shell_dialogs.gyp:shell_dialogs', 1017 '../ui/shell_dialogs/shell_dialogs.gyp:shell_dialogs',
1018 'content.gyp:content_v8_external_data', 1018 'content.gyp:content_shell_assets_copy',
1019 ], 1019 ],
1020 }], 1020 }],
1021 ['v8_use_external_startup_data==1 and OS!="ios"', { 1021 ['v8_use_external_startup_data==1 and OS!="ios"', {
1022 'dependencies': [ 1022 'dependencies': [
1023 '../gin/gin.gyp:gin', 1023 '../gin/gin.gyp:gin',
1024 ], 1024 ],
1025 }], 1025 }],
1026 ], 1026 ],
1027 }, 1027 },
1028 { 1028 {
(...skipping 836 matching lines...) Expand 10 before | Expand all | Expand 10 after
1865 'type': 'none', 1865 'type': 'none',
1866 'dependencies': [ 1866 'dependencies': [
1867 'content.gyp:content_java', 1867 'content.gyp:content_java',
1868 'content_unittests', 1868 'content_unittests',
1869 ], 1869 ],
1870 'conditions': [ 1870 'conditions': [
1871 ['v8_use_external_startup_data==1', { 1871 ['v8_use_external_startup_data==1', {
1872 'dependencies': [ 1872 'dependencies': [
1873 '../v8/tools/gyp/v8.gyp:v8_external_snapshot', 1873 '../v8/tools/gyp/v8.gyp:v8_external_snapshot',
1874 ], 1874 ],
1875 'copies': [ 1875 'variables': {
1876 { 1876 'dest_path': '<(asset_location)',
1877 'destination': '<(asset_location)', 1877 'renaming_sources': [
1878 'files': [ 1878 '<(PRODUCT_DIR)/natives_blob.bin',
1879 '<(PRODUCT_DIR)/natives_blob.bin', 1879 '<(PRODUCT_DIR)/snapshot_blob.bin',
1880 '<(PRODUCT_DIR)/snapshot_blob.bin', 1880 ],
1881 ], 1881 'renaming_destinations': [
1882 }, 1882 'natives_blob_<(arch_suffix).bin',
1883 ], 1883 'snapshot_blob_<(arch_suffix).bin',
1884 ],
1885 'clear': 1,
1886 },
1887 'includes': ['../build/android/copy_ex.gypi'],
1884 }], 1888 }],
1885 ], 1889 ],
1886 'variables': { 1890 'variables': {
1887 'test_suite_name': 'content_unittests', 1891 'test_suite_name': 'content_unittests',
1888 'isolate_file': 'content_unittests.isolate', 1892 'isolate_file': 'content_unittests.isolate',
1889 'conditions': [ 1893 'conditions': [
1890 ['v8_use_external_startup_data==1', { 1894 ['v8_use_external_startup_data==1', {
1891 'asset_location': '<(PRODUCT_DIR)/content_unittests_apk/assets', 1895 'asset_location': '<(PRODUCT_DIR)/content_unittests_apk/assets',
1892 'additional_input_paths': [ 1896 'additional_input_paths': [
1893 '<(PRODUCT_DIR)/content_unittests_apk/assets/natives_blob.bin' , 1897 '<(PRODUCT_DIR)/content_unittests_apk/assets/natives_blob_<(ar ch_suffix).bin',
1894 '<(PRODUCT_DIR)/content_unittests_apk/assets/snapshot_blob.bin ', 1898 '<(PRODUCT_DIR)/content_unittests_apk/assets/snapshot_blob_<(a rch_suffix).bin',
1895 ], 1899 ],
1896 }], 1900 }],
1897 ], 1901 ],
1898 }, 1902 },
1899 'includes': [ '../build/apk_test.gypi' ], 1903 'includes': [
1904 '../build/apk_test.gypi',
1905 '../build/android/v8_external_startup_data_arch_suffix.gypi',
1906 ],
1900 }, 1907 },
1901 { 1908 {
1902 'target_name': 'content_shell_browsertests_java', 1909 'target_name': 'content_shell_browsertests_java',
1903 'type': 'none', 1910 'type': 'none',
1904 'dependencies': [ 1911 'dependencies': [
1905 'content.gyp:content_java', 1912 'content.gyp:content_java',
1906 'content_shell_java', 1913 'content_shell_java',
1907 '../base/base.gyp:base_java', 1914 '../base/base.gyp:base_java',
1908 '../testing/android/native_test.gyp:native_test_java', 1915 '../testing/android/native_test.gyp:native_test_java',
1909 '../ui/android/ui_android.gyp:ui_java', 1916 '../ui/android/ui_android.gyp:ui_java',
(...skipping 11 matching lines...) Expand all
1921 'jinja_inputs': ['shell/android/browsertests_apk/AndroidManifest.xml .jinja2'], 1928 'jinja_inputs': ['shell/android/browsertests_apk/AndroidManifest.xml .jinja2'],
1922 'jinja_output': '<(SHARED_INTERMEDIATE_DIR)/content_browsertests_man ifest/AndroidManifest.xml', 1929 'jinja_output': '<(SHARED_INTERMEDIATE_DIR)/content_browsertests_man ifest/AndroidManifest.xml',
1923 }, 1930 },
1924 'includes': [ '../build/android/jinja_template.gypi' ], 1931 'includes': [ '../build/android/jinja_template.gypi' ],
1925 }, 1932 },
1926 { 1933 {
1927 # TODO(GN) 1934 # TODO(GN)
1928 'target_name': 'content_browsertests_apk', 1935 'target_name': 'content_browsertests_apk',
1929 'type': 'none', 1936 'type': 'none',
1930 'dependencies': [ 1937 'dependencies': [
1931 'content.gyp:content_icudata', 1938 'content.gyp:content_shell_assets_copy',
1932 'content.gyp:content_java', 1939 'content.gyp:content_java',
1933 'content.gyp:content_v8_external_data',
1934 'content_browsertests', 1940 'content_browsertests',
1935 'content_shell_browsertests_java', 1941 'content_shell_browsertests_java',
1936 'content_java_test_support', 1942 'content_java_test_support',
1937 'content_shell_java', 1943 'content_shell_java',
1938 ], 1944 ],
1939 'variables': { 1945 'variables': {
1940 'test_suite_name': 'content_browsertests', 1946 'test_suite_name': 'content_browsertests',
1941 'isolate_file': 'content_browsertests.isolate', 1947 'isolate_file': 'content_browsertests.isolate',
1942 'java_in_dir': 'shell/android/browsertests_apk', 1948 'java_in_dir': 'shell/android/browsertests_apk',
1943 'android_manifest_path': '<(SHARED_INTERMEDIATE_DIR)/content_browser tests_manifest/AndroidManifest.xml', 1949 'android_manifest_path': '<(SHARED_INTERMEDIATE_DIR)/content_browser tests_manifest/AndroidManifest.xml',
(...skipping 45 matching lines...) Expand 10 before | Expand all | Expand 10 after
1989 'includes': [ '../build/android/jinja_template.gypi' ], 1995 'includes': [ '../build/android/jinja_template.gypi' ],
1990 }, 1996 },
1991 { 1997 {
1992 # GN: //content/shell/android:chromium_linker_test_apk 1998 # GN: //content/shell/android:chromium_linker_test_apk
1993 'target_name': 'chromium_linker_test_apk', 1999 'target_name': 'chromium_linker_test_apk',
1994 'type': 'none', 2000 'type': 'none',
1995 'conditions': [ 2001 'conditions': [
1996 ['target_arch != "x64"', { 2002 ['target_arch != "x64"', {
1997 'dependencies': [ 2003 'dependencies': [
1998 'chromium_android_linker_test', 2004 'chromium_android_linker_test',
1999 'content.gyp:content_icudata', 2005 'content.gyp:content_shell_assets_copy',
2000 'content.gyp:content_java', 2006 'content.gyp:content_java',
2001 'content.gyp:content_v8_external_data',
2002 'content_shell_java', 2007 'content_shell_java',
2003 ], 2008 ],
2004 'variables': { 2009 'variables': {
2005 'apk_name': 'ChromiumLinkerTest', 2010 'apk_name': 'ChromiumLinkerTest',
2006 'android_manifest_path': '<(SHARED_INTERMEDIATE_DIR)/chromium_li nker_test_manifest/AndroidManifest.xml', 2011 'android_manifest_path': '<(SHARED_INTERMEDIATE_DIR)/chromium_li nker_test_manifest/AndroidManifest.xml',
2007 'java_in_dir': 'shell/android/linker_test_apk', 2012 'java_in_dir': 'shell/android/linker_test_apk',
2008 'resource_dir': 'shell/android/linker_test_apk/res', 2013 'resource_dir': 'shell/android/linker_test_apk/res',
2009 'native_lib_target': 'libchromium_android_linker_test', 2014 'native_lib_target': 'libchromium_android_linker_test',
2010 'additional_input_paths': ['<(PRODUCT_DIR)/content_shell/assets/ content_shell.pak'], 2015 'additional_input_paths': ['<(PRODUCT_DIR)/content_shell/assets/ content_shell.pak'],
2011 'asset_location': '<(PRODUCT_DIR)/content_shell/assets', 2016 'asset_location': '<(PRODUCT_DIR)/content_shell/assets',
(...skipping 186 matching lines...) Expand 10 before | Expand all | Expand 10 after
2198 'content_unittests_apk.isolate', 2203 'content_unittests_apk.isolate',
2199 ], 2204 ],
2200 }, 2205 },
2201 ], 2206 ],
2202 }, 2207 },
2203 ], 2208 ],
2204 ], 2209 ],
2205 }], 2210 }],
2206 ], 2211 ],
2207 } 2212 }
OLDNEW
« no previous file with comments | « content/content_shell.gypi ('k') | content/shell/android/BUILD.gn » ('j') | no next file with comments »

Powered by Google App Engine
This is Rietveld 408576698